I have €180. I exchanged it at €1.2 to £1 . how much do I get back in sterling

               (180 €) x (1 £ / 1.2 €)

           =  (180 · 1 / 1.2) x ( € · £ / € )

           =     £ 150         minus the exchanger's commission.
